Before connecting a WhatsApp number via QR code on WaFloW.ai, it is important to meet a series of technical and operational requirements.
Scanning the QR code without these conditions may result in connection failures, frequent disconnections, or crashes.
Account and subaccount requirements #
Before scanning the QR code, please ensure that:
- The subaccount is active in WaFloW.ai.
- WaFloW.ai is correctly installed in GoHighLevel.
- Permissions in GHL are authorized.
- You can access the subaccount without errors.
If any of these points fail, do not proceed with the QR connection.
Phone requirements #
The phone containing the WhatsApp number must meet the following requirements:
- Have WhatsApp up and running.
- Be turned on and have sufficient battery power.
- Have a stable internet connection (WiFi or data).
- Have the latest version of WhatsApp installed.
Recommendation: Use a dedicated and stable phone.
WhatsApp number requirements #
To minimize risks:
- The number must be verified by WhatsApp.
- Avoid newly created numbers with no history.
- Do not use numbers that have been previously blocked.
- Do not connect the same number to multiple systems at the same time.
A number with normal and stable usage has less risk of problems.
Environment requirements #
During QR scanning:
- Do not close the WaFloW.ai window.
- Do not change the network on your phone.
- Do not lock your phone screen.
- Avoid using VPNs or unstable networks.
These factors can disrupt bonding.
Recommendations prior to scanning #
Before scanning the QR code, it is advisable to:
- Define the role of the number (sales, support, etc.).
- Be clear about the correct subaccount.
- Review basic device settings.
- Do not scan the QR code multiple times in a row.
A clean connection on the first try is ideal.
What NOT to do before scanning the QR code #
- ❌ Do not use personal numbers that are in heavy simultaneous use.
- ❌ Do not scan from shared devices.
- ❌ Do not connect "test" numbers in production.
- ❌ Do not scan if WhatsApp displays previous alerts.
